What Is an Iterated Integral?

An iterated integral is a double integral computed one variable at a time.

It is written in the form:

∫∫ f(x, y) dy dx
or
∫∫ f(x, y) dx dy

The order of integration matters because you integrate one variable first, then the other.

Calculation Logic

The tool performs integration in two stages:

Step 1:

Integrate the function with respect to the inner variable while treating the outer variable as constant.

Step 2:

Integrate the result with respect to the outer variable.


Practical Example

Evaluate:

∫ from x=0 to 2
∫ from y=0 to 3
(x + y) dy dx

Step 1: Integrate with respect to y

∫ (x + y) dy
= xy + y²/2

Evaluate from 0 to 3:

= 3x + 9/2

Step 2: Integrate with respect to x

∫ (3x + 9/2) dx
= (3x²/2) + (9x/2)

Evaluate from 0 to 2:

= 6 + 9
= 15

Final Answer: 15

Applications of Iterated Integrals

  • Calculating area of regions
  • Finding volume under surfaces
  • Engineering computations
  • Physics field calculations
  • Probability density functions
